56450ea705b662c2b2284c9659235055f44e12e708774faa56aede09b6e96a11

1507062 (271295 blocks ago)

⏴ Block 1507061 (75890309…e76) | Block 1507063 ⏵ | Latest block ⏭

Metadata

27/01/2024, 19:26 UTC (376d 19:10:58 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details